Postdoctoral Associate - BioSciences
Rice University is looking to hire a Postdoctoral Research Associate in the field of Biochemistry and Cell Biology. The role involves conducting research on the interplay between the nervous and immune systems, focusing on microglia in zebrafish to address questions in neuroimmunology.

Responsibilities
Assists in designing CRISPRs targeting genes associated with neurological disorders, generates CRISPR-Cas9 mutants in zebrafish, and maintains fish lines
Assists with performing molecular biology experiments such as PCR assays, isolation and purification of DNA/RNA, and cloning of transgenes
Documents, analyzes, and maintains research data
Assists with proposal development to obtain research funding
Mentors, oversees, and/or trains junior research team members
Publishes and presents research findings
Supports project management and collaboration across institutions or disciplines
Designs and implements research protocols; adapts new procedures, methods or instrumentation relative to research procedures
Performs all other duties as assigned
Qualification
Required
Ph.D in Life Sciences or related field
Knowledge of tissue culture
Experience with animal husbandry and maintenance
Expertise in molecular biology and genetics (for e.g. CRISPR technology, cloning, DNA sequencing, etc.)
Excellent verbal and written communication skills, as well as oral presentation skills
Organization and time management skills
Knowledge of modern research methods, data collection, and analyses
Knowledge of the principles and techniques of Biochemistry and Cell Biology
Ability to write scholarly papers based on ongoing research in order to submit them to journals for publication
Able to work in a collaborative environment
Able to work independently and professionally with minimal supervision and direction
